Chain and plug, Click Clack or perhaps Pop Up Waste You will find 3 basic types of waste kit. The standard plug and chain waste is well known to everyone. A retainer plug and chain waste is certainly one where the plug works in to the overflow grill when not in use to ensure that it stays dealt with. Plug and chain wastes generally come with possibly a ball chain or a link chain. Most chain and plug wastes are going to fit most freestanding baths. A simply click clack trash is one that has a sprung plug which works like a number of contemporary basin wastes, you push the plug in which clicks shut, push it all over again to simply click it opened, with click clack wastes a chrome cover matches over the overflow hole but appears slightly proud serotonin so concerning not block it. A pop up waste is a single that's controlled by a chrome switch which fits over the overflow, a cable uses the outside of the tub from the switch on the plug and rotating the switch will cause the cable to go and operate the plug. Most click clack and pop up waste sold in major chains won't fit in most traditional freestanding roll top baths.

Concealed or Exposed Waste Kit
A concealed waste set up is certainly one which is assumed to be fitted in situations in which solely those elements which are fitted inside the bath is going to be found, so that all of the pipe work on the outdoors of the bath - the overflow pipe, hole and outlet pipe is usually plastic. An uncovered waste package is all metal/chrome with no plastic components and is all meant to be seen. A traditional double ended freestanding bath when placed about against a wall may be outfitted with a concealed waste package since the pipework is going to be hidden in between the tub and the wall. A single ended regular freestanding bath will usually have all the pipework noticeable when viewed in profile anywhere you get it really for these and for double ended baths that are away from the wall you'd probably fit an exposed waste kit with a chrome trap as well as outlet pipe.

Thickness of Freestanding Baths Most standard freestanding baths are far thicker compared to typical panel baths and this could trigger a difficulty with many waste systems. All waste products systems have a parts that sit on either side of the plug and overflow holes and connect in concert to create a sandwich structure with all the wall of the warm water getting the sandwich filling and parts of the waste system on each side. For plug and chain takes up the components of the squandering systems usually connect with a threaded bolt so as long as the bolts are long enough (which they normally are) then these kits will place on any thickness of overflow or plug hole. However most click pop as well as clack up wastes use rather than a bolt a wide bore plastic threaded tube that may be only 7 to twelve mm thick, this is not hick enough for the majority of traditional roll top baths.

Waste Pipe and Overflow Pipe Conflicts When suiting an ultra shallow bath trap you are going to find that the outlet pipe will run out at the same level as the overflow pipe is packaged in (or at least at overlapping heights). This suggests that you can point the outlet pipe in virtually any direction (by spinning the trap) although you cannot point it also out directly just how that the overflow pipe is arriving as it won't place underneath it. If you need to take the waste out towards the conclusion or maybe edge of the tub in which the overflow is after this you can reuse an outlet pipe with a right angle to run the outlet pipe out to left or maybe right of the overflow pipe.

Lengthy Overflow
If the tub features a plug hole that is centered in the bathtub both length-ways and width-ways then you will need an extended overflow pipe. In addition if you are fitting a pop-up waste you will need one with a prolonged cable and if fitting a plug and chain waste you'll need one with a lengthy chain. In the case of fitting an exposed waste kit with a metal overflow pipe you are going to need to fit a chrome overflow extension pipe, these are kind of specialist things and only offered from a few of freestanding bath specialists. If the plug hole is in the center length ways but more than to one side, the edge where the overflow is, width ways after that you do not need the extended waste kits just simply described.

Freestanding Baths Without Feet
Lots of fashionable freestanding baths don't have feet but have in integral' skirt' that goes right down on the floor. In these cases the waste system in most cases fits up inside in between the two' skins' of the bathtub, hence the overflow pipe is never found. Furthermore these style of bath are generally reinforced with board like the average bath and so are thin (> 10mm) and often will fit most typical pop-up and after that click clack wastes. A few standard baths, especially boat baths are similarly constructed, however many boat baths majority on a plinth as well as may have a tub a lot more like a bath with feet having a visible overflow pipe and thick foundation and wall.
